Analysis

Norway recorded 164,749 for population ages 10-14, male in 2025.

That represents a change of down 1.3% on the previous year and up 5.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, population ages 10-14, male in Norway peaked at 170,943 in 1980 and was at its lowest, 133,804, in 1995.

Norway ranks 125th of 215 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 157,247 154,576 162,964 10
1970s 161,498 156,841 170,455 10
1980s 158,977 138,969 170,943 10
1990s 135,784 133,804 142,754 10
2000s 158,470 147,861 161,821 10
2010s 159,946 156,915 165,327 10
2020s 167,779 164,749 169,573 6
